HEREFORD Cathedral has reported a dramatic increase in visitor figures for the past year, thanks to TV coverage and a local tourism team.

More than 25,000 people attended special services throughout December, and millions more tuned in to the BBC's Songs of Praise Christmas special, which was filmed at the Cathedral back in November.

Press officer Dominic Harbour said carol services on December 22 and 23 were packed to capacity, almost all school carol services throughout the month were full and that the Christmas Day services were also well attended.
